Police are reminding cottage owners this is the time of year to take a few simple steps that could prevent break ins this winter.
OPP say when closing up your summer home for the season, make sure all windows and doors are locked. There is no food or alcohol left behind, lock up all valuables and disable vehicles that will be left on site. Police also recommend you leave your information and a key with someone who might live close to the building if you are unable to check on it from time to time. Police also say taking pictures, recording serial numbers of items and knowing which police unit services your area and having their number is also an essential step to ensuring you are as prepared and protected as possible.
